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$633 in Ballito versus $1,425 in Johannesburg.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$982 in Ballito versus $2,190 in Johannesburg.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$1,331 in Ballito versus $2,955 in Johannesburg.

Living in Ballito costs roughly 56% less than in Johannesburg, driven mainly by Getting Around.

The two cities straddle the global median: Ballito is 54% below, Johannesburg is 4% above.
